Output 8c904845bde986944c16c3ab189b97b31bbba81fb12fef258b4f3a8457fdc3a3:1

value
2884131
script pubkey
OP_0 OP_PUSHBYTES_20 58f9d8728693a4301f1a200cc5f0f3779c4ef106
address
ltc1qtruasu5xjwjrq8c6yqxvtu8nw7wyaugxz0hpzn
transaction
8c904845bde986944c16c3ab189b97b31bbba81fb12fef258b4f3a8457fdc3a3
spent
true